‘Lamborne’ is a larger-than-expected (1181 square feet), detached bungalow situated in a secret, ‘tucked away’ location in a small, gated community, a short walk to Sherborne town centre and mainline railway station to London. The bungalow benefits from a level, private south facing rear garden providing quite the suntrap plus side garden. There is driveway parking for one to three cars leading to a single integral garage with automatic roller door. The bungalow offers deceptively spacious, well laid out, flexible accommodation extending to 1181 square feet plus the appeal of excellent levels of natural light from dual aspects and a sunny southerly aspect at the rear. It is heated by a mains gas fired radiator central heating system and also benefits from uPVC double glazing. The well laid out accommodation comprises entrance porch, entrance reception hall, sitting room / dining room, garden room, kitchen / breakfast room, master double bedroom with en-suite shower room, second double bedroom and a family shower room / WC. It is a short walk to the vibrant, historic town centre of Sherborne with its superb boutique high street with cafes, restaurants, Waitrose store and independent shops plus the breath-taking Abbey, Almshouses and Sherborne’s world-famous private schools. It is also a short walk to the mainline railway station making London Waterloo directly reachable in just over two hours. Sherborne has recently won the award for the best place to live in the South West by The Times 2024. It also boasts ‘The Sherborne’ – a top class, recently opened arts and conference centre plus superb restaurant. The location of the property offers excellent access to the A303 trunk road to London and Exeter and the A30 to Salisbury.
